Why Smartphone Buyers Are Choosing Samsung and Apple over Xiaomi, OPPO, and Vivo in Q1-2026
Why It Matters
The shift rewards ecosystem‑rich premium brands and forces mid‑range manufacturers to rethink value propositions, reshaping supply chains and profit margins across the smartphone industry.
Key Takeaways
- •Samsung Q1 shipments rose to 62.8 M, share 21.7%
- •Apple shipments hit 61.1 M, market share 21.1%
- •Xiaomi, OPPO, Vivo shipments fell over 10% YoY
- •Total shipments dropped 4.1% to 289.7 M units
- •Consumers choosing premium brands, extending upgrade cycles
Pulse Analysis
Premium smartphones are gaining traction as consumers prioritize durability, camera quality, and integrated ecosystems over price. Samsung and Apple have leveraged stable software updates and brand trust to capture a larger slice of the high‑end market, even as they restrained price hikes. This behavior reflects broader macro‑economic caution, where higher disposable income is funneled into devices that promise longer service life, reducing the frequency of replacement cycles.
Mid‑range manufacturers such as Xiaomi, OPPO and Vivo now face a double‑edged challenge: shrinking volumes and eroding relevance in a market that increasingly values premium features. To regain momentum, they must differentiate through innovative hardware, aggressive pricing, or niche software experiences that can compete with the ecosystem lock‑in of Apple and Samsung. The decline in their shipments also ripples through component suppliers, particularly those focused on mid‑tier SoCs, displays, and camera modules, prompting a reallocation of production capacity toward higher‑margin segments.
Looking ahead, the contraction in overall shipments suggests that upgrade cycles will lengthen, pressuring carriers and retailers to adjust inventory strategies and financing offers. Brands that can blend premium performance with competitive pricing may capture the emerging “affordable‑premium” niche, while advertisers will need to target a more discerning audience that values long‑term value over immediate cost savings. The Q1 2026 data thus signals a pivotal realignment toward quality‑centric consumption in the global smartphone market.
